This footage is a little old now (Oct 11) but shows the initial linear training level with a lot of impressive new gameplay elements not present in the previous games. The graphics are amazing to boot:
The game features an 'instinct' system, similar in style to Assassin's Creed's Eagle Vision, which allows 47 to predict the route of his targets to aid with stealth. Combat has been given a boost with a 'paint and shoot' mechanic similar to Red Dead's Dead Eye mode. The usage of such tools are restricted a meter which builds based on certain actions the player performs.
The final game will feature the same style open-world type levels as in the previous iterations with several different approaches to taking out your target.

I love the Hitman series but I am not excited about this game at all. Hitman is about sandbox freedom, slow-paced exploration, observation and careful execution of your plan, in pursuit of the elusive Silent Assassin rank. This game just seems like too much of a departure from the tone and style of the series and from what I've read appears to be a linear set-piece fest. Agent 47 vs a helicopter? What?
Plus they dropped Jesper Kyd, whose music was a huge part of the atmosphere of the previous games.

Finished this on Friday - it is AMAZING. Some brilliant open-plan missions connected via some stellar puzzley sneaky bits.
I was a bit disappointed that The Saints didn't feature more heavily, and there's a twist at the end which (while it made me very happy) was a little implausible.
The online Contracts mode works really well too - you play a level and mark targets for death and kill them how you want them killed, and then people online can try and beat your created mission. Some Greek guy played my contract 14 times but didn't give it a thumbs up. Rude :|
